US spot Bitcoin ETFs saw net outflows of $829.9 million this week
net outflow of the US spot Bitcoin ETF this week was $829.9 million, with a total reduction of 10,358.34 BTC. Only 160.44 BTC flowed in on Wednesday, with net outflows for the rest of the time. BlackRock reduced holdings by 4,239.38 BTC, while Fidelity reduced holdings by 3,813.02 BTC. The current price is hovering around $84,000, with a market fear and greed index of 30 (fear). Short-term market sentiment is low, with the March 20 Federal Reserve interest rate meeting and the tariffs to be implemented in April challenging market confidence.
